IPRS introduces innovative digital series, “IPRS CreativeShala” that is all about creatively utilizing the newfound leisure time and being positive amidst the crisis. It’s an exciting opportunity for all music enthusiasts to hear from the experts in the field of music and enhance their skill set or rekindle their passion for music. IPRS CreativeShala series will entail a series of jamming sessions with a fun blend of masterclass, interviews, workshop and live chat by well-known musicians, composers, lyricists and authors on music and creative writing, streaming LIVE every Thursday & Sunday on Instagram at 7 pm.

The first session of the IPRS Creative Shala series took place on 30th March on Instagram wherein ace artists Anupam Roy & Mayur Puri spoke about their fascinating musical journey. The secret behind their iconic compositions and shared their learnings with the audience. The session became lively with Anupam performing his popular hits requested by the audience.

Anupam Roy is a popular Indian singer, lyricist, composer and playback singer from Kolkata, West Bengal. He is best known for his song Amake Amar Moto Thakte Dao (Autograph-2010) & composing the songs and score for Piku. He was nominated for the 61st Filmfare Award for Best Music Director and won the 61st Filmfare Award for Best Background Score for Piku.  Mayur Puri is an Indian screenwriter, lyricist, actor, and film-maker. He wrote songs, screenplays and dialogue for several movies, including Om Shanti Om starring Shahrukh Khan directed by Farah Khan. Additionally, He also wrote dialogue for Farah Khan’s film Happy New Year (2014).

The second session of IPRS CreativeShala that is scheduled for Thursday will be conducted by the famous Priya Saraiya (Panchal). She is an Indian playback singer and lyricist in Bollywood. She is also a live stage singer for Bollywood and Gujarati Folk Songs.  Over and above her performance and stories from her musical journey, Priya Saraiya (Panchal) will be discussing about recording techniques and tips about how to avoid regional accent while performing a Hindi song. The session with Priya in talks with Mayur Puri will take place on Thursday, 2nd April 2020 at 7:00 pm on their respective Instagram handle.
